Les Attaques
Les Attaques is a commune in the Pas-de-Calais department in the Hauts-de-France region of France.
Geography
A large farming and light industrial village located 4 miles southeast of Calais, at the junction of the N43 and D248 roads. Both the A26 "autoroute des Anglais" and the Calais-St. Omer canal pass through the commune.Population
Sights
- The church of St. Pierre, dating from the nineteenth century.
- The nineteenth-century chateau Brûlé.
- Vestiges of a Capuchin abbey.
- A rare four-branch bridge
